Crochet: Cowl
The Lattice Cowl uses a combination of single crochet, double crochet, and chain spaces to create a lattice pattern in this small, pretty cowl. This sample was made with a silk and alpaca blend, which makes it especially drapey. It’s a great layering piece to help keep your neck warm and add a little flair to any outfit.

Crochet: Cowl
The Mokuti Cowl is a warm and colorful piece, created using the crochet linen stitch. The name comes from my husband, who collects metal tools. When he saw this piece, he thought it looked similar to the Mokuti effect, which combines multiple metals to create an interesting color design.
Crochet: Shawl / Wrap
The King’s Cross Stole is a lightweight stole with a combination of lacey stitches between waves of double crochet, giving it both structure and beauty. The name came from my husband, Tommy, who thought it looked like a bridge across water and felt it needed a bold name. You’ll love adding this stylish piece to your wardrobe.
